Drip Irrigation Sales Market Outlook

The global drip irrigation sales market is poised to reach approximately USD 4.2 billion by 2035, with a robust comp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of about 12% during the forecast period from 2025 to 2035. This growth can be attributed to increasing water scarcity, the rising need for food production efficiency, and growing awareness of sustainable agricultural practices among farmers worldwide. As climate change continues to impact traditional farming methods, the demand for more efficient irrigation systems is surging, leading to a shift toward drip irrigation technologies. Additionally, government initiatives promoting water conservation and efficient agricultural practices are further driving market growth, alongside advancements in irrigation technology that enhance the efficiency and effectiveness of drip irrigation systems.

By Product Type

Drip Emitters:

Drip emitters are a fundamental component of drip irrigation systems, responsible for regulating the flow of water to the plants. They are designed to deliver a specific volume of water at a controlled rate, ensuring that plants receive the right amount of moisture without wastage. The increased adoption of precision agriculture practices is driving the demand for advanced drip emitters that can operate efficiently under varying conditions. Innovations such as pressure-compensating emitters, which maintain a consistent flow rate regardless of variations in pressure, are gaining popularity, thereby enhancing system efficiency. Additionally, the growing trend toward automation in irrigation is contributing to the increased production and utilization of high-tech drip emitters that integrate with modern agricultural sensors and control systems.

Drip Tubes:

Drip tubes are integral to the distribution of water in drip irrigation systems, serving as the conduit through which water flows from the source to the emitters. The demand for drip tubes is increasing due to their versatility and effectiveness in delivering water to various crops efficiently. These tubes come in various diameters and materials, allowing for customization based on specific agricultural needs. As the focus on sustainable farming practices intensifies, farmers are increasingly opting for high-quality, durable drip tubes that can withstand harsh environmental conditions while minimizing water loss due to evaporation. Innovations in materials, such as UV-resistant and biodegradable options, are also contributing to the growth of the drip tube segment, as they align with the overall sustainability goals of modern agriculture.

Drip Lines:

Drip lines are specialized tubing that incorporates multiple emitters along its length, allowing for even distribution of water across a wider area. The rising adoption of drip lines is attributed to their efficiency in irrigating row crops and large-scale agricultural fields, where uniform water distribution is crucial for maximizing yields. These systems are designed to minimize pressure loss and ensure consistent flow rates throughout the irrigation process. Moreover, the convenience of installation and maintenance associated with drip lines makes them a preferred choice among farmers. The increasing demand for high-yield crops and the need for efficient land use are further driving the growth of this segment, as drip lines can be easily adjusted to cater to varying crop requirements.

Filters:

Filters play a crucial role in drip irrigation systems by preventing clogging of emitters and ensuring that clean water is delivered to plants. The growing emphasis on maintaining water quality in agricultural practices is driving the demand for advanced filtration solutions. There are several types of filters used in drip irrigation, including disc filters, screen filters, and media filters, each tailored to different water quality requirements. As farmers seek to optimize their irrigation systems, the integration of self-cleaning filter technologies is becoming increasingly popular, as they reduce maintenance needs and ensure continuous operation. Additionally, legislation aimed at improving water quality and sustainability is also propelling the growth of the filter segment within the drip irrigation market.

Valves:

Valves are essential components of drip irrigation systems that control the flow of water, allowing for precise management of irrigation schedules and volumes. The increasing adoption of automated irrigation solutions is significantly driving the demand for advanced valve systems that integrate with smart technology. These valves not only facilitate efficient water management but also help in conserving resources by preventing over-irrigation. The trend towards smart agriculture and the use of IoT devices for monitoring and controlling irrigation systems are fueling innovations in valve technology, leading to the development of remote-controlled and pressure-regulating valves. As farmers become more conscious of water conservation and seek to automate their irrigation processes, the valves segment is expected to witness substantial growth in the coming years.

By Application

Agriculture:

The agriculture sector constitutes the largest application segment for drip irrigation systems, primarily due to the increasing global demand for food production. As water scarcity becomes a pressing issue, farmers are increasingly turning to drip irrigation to maximize crop yield while minimizing water usage. Drip irrigation allows for targeted watering, reducing runoff and evaporation losses, which is particularly beneficial in arid and semi-arid regions. Moreover, the ability to integrate drip irrigation with precision agriculture technologies enhances crop management and improves overall efficiency. As a result, the agricultural application of drip irrigation is expected to dominate the market throughout the forecast period, driven by the need for sustainable farming practices and higher productivity.

Landscape & Turf:

Drip irrigation is gaining traction in the landscape and turf management sector due to its efficiency in maintaining green spaces, gardens, and lawns. This application is particularly relevant in urban areas where water conservation is critical. The increasing awareness of sustainable landscaping practices is prompting landscape professionals and homeowners to adopt drip irrigation systems as they provide a targeted and efficient watering method. These systems reduce water waste and ensure that plants receive consistent moisture, promoting healthy growth. As more municipalities implement water-use regulations, the landscape and turf application of drip irrigation is expected to grow, supported by advancements in smart irrigation technologies that offer greater control and customization.

Greenhouse:

In greenhouse operations, drip irrigation is favored for its ability to provide precise moisture control, which is essential for optimizing plant growth. The controlled environment of greenhouses allows for the effective use of drip systems, as they can be tailored to meet the specific needs of various crops. The increasing trend toward urban agriculture and vertical farming is further driving the adoption of drip irrigation in greenhouses, as these systems promote efficient water use and contribute to sustainable practices. Moreover, the integration of technology, such as automated drip systems and soil moisture sensors, enhances the efficiency of drip irrigation in greenhouse applications, leading to improved crop yields and resource management.

Threats

Despite the promising growth trajectory of the drip irrigation sales market, several threats could hinder its progress. One of the most significant concerns is the high initial investment required for installing drip irrigation systems. Many smallholder farmers may find it challenging to afford the upfront costs associated with these systems, resulting in a slower adoption rate in certain regions, particularly in developing countries. Additionally, the complexity of installation, maintenance, and repair can pose challenges for farmers unfamiliar with advanced irrigation technologies. This could lead to frustration and potential abandonment of the systems, ultimately impacting the market's growth potential. Furthermore, fluctuations in raw material prices used in manufacturing drip irrigation components can adversely affect the pricing strategies and profitability of market players.

Another factor posing a threat to the drip irrigation sales market is the competition from alternative irrigation methods, such as sprinkler irrigation and traditional flood irrigation systems. While drip irrigation offers numerous advantages, some farmers may prefer conventional methods due to familiarity and ease of use. Additionally, regions with abundant water resources may not prioritize the adoption of water-efficient irrigation techniques. This could lead to a lack of awareness and understanding of the benefits of drip irrigation among certain farming communities. Addressing these challenges will be crucial for market players seeking to maintain their competitive edge and ensure the continued growth of the drip irrigation sales market.
